Question -
if a single letter is drawn from the set m,a,t,h what is the probability that the letter drawn is a memeber of the set m,a,t,h,e,i,c? the answer is 1 but how do you get that
an ordinary deck of 52 playing cards the determine the probability ? a face card is drawn. 4/13 how do you get that
a non-face card or a card showing a 5 . 9/13 how do get that
each leter of the alphabet is carefully printed on a pieces of paper form a bowl. an individaul pieces is selected. the letter is consonant? the letter is formed form straight line segments only? the letter has ab enclosed region in its representation?
Answer -
Hi Veronica,
if we pick a letter form the set A={m,a,t,h}, then, it is with 100% certainty that we have picked a letter from the set B={m,a,t,h,e,i,c}, since all elements in A are contained in the superset B.
the face cards refer to J,Q,K or A.
there are four suits. so we have
SpadeJ,SpadeQ,SpadeK,SpadeA
HeartJ,HeartQ,HeartK,HeartA
ClubJ,ClubQ,ClubK,ClubA
DiamondJ,DiamondQ,DiamondK,DiamondA
to pick one of these out of a deck of 52, we have a chance of 16/52, which simplifies to 4/13.
rather than listing them here, best thing for you to do is to look at a deck of cards. basically, for each suit, the numbers 2-9 inclusive all satisfy this criteria.
multiply by 4 and you get 9*4=36.
This divided by 52 gives the ratio 9/13
